/** * Starter Content Compatibility. * * @since 4.0.0 * @package Astra */ /** * Class Astre_Starter_Content */ class Astra_Starter_Content { public const HOME_SLUG = 'home'; public const ABOUT_SLUG = '#about'; public const SERVICES_SLUG = '#services'; public const REVIEWS_SLUG = '#reviews'; public const WHY_US_SLUG = '#whyus'; public const CONTACT_SLUG = '#contact'; /** * Constructor */ public function __construct() { $is_fresh_site = get_option( 'fresh_site' ); if ( ! $is_fresh_site ) { return; } // Adding post meta and inserting post. add_action( 'wp_insert_post', array( $this, 'register_listener', ), 3, 99 ); // Save astra settings into database. add_action( 'customize_save_after', array( $this, 'save_astra_settings', ), 10, 3 ); if ( ! is_customize_preview() ) { return; } // preview customizer values. add_filter( 'default_post_metadata', array( $this, 'starter_meta' ), 99, 3 ); add_filter( 'astra_theme_defaults', array( $this, 'theme_defaults' ) ); add_filter( 'astra_global_color_palette', array( $this, 'theme_color_palettes_defaults' ) ); } /** * Load default starter meta. * * @since 4.0.2 * @param mixed $value Value. * @param int $post_id Post id. * @param string $meta_key Meta key. * * @return string Meta value. */ public function starter_meta( $value, $post_id, $meta_key ) { if ( get_post_type( $post_id ) !== 'page' ) { return $value; } if ( 'site-content-layout' === $meta_key ) { return 'plain-container'; } if ( 'theme-transparent-header-meta' === $meta_key ) { return 'enabled'; } if ( 'site-sidebar-layout' === $meta_key ) { return 'no-sidebar'; } if ( 'site-post-title' === $meta_key ) { return 'disabled'; } return $value; } /** * Register listener to insert post. * * @since 4.0.0 * @param int $post_ID Post Id. * @param \WP_Post $post Post object. * @param bool $update Is update. */ public function register_listener( $post_ID, $post, $update ) { if ( $update ) { return; } $custom_draft_post_name = get_post_meta( $post_ID, '_customize_draft_post_name', true ); $is_from_starter_content = ! empty( $custom_draft_post_name ); if ( ! $is_from_starter_content ) { return; } if ( 'page' === $post->post_type ) { update_post_meta( $post_ID, 'site-content-layout', 'plain-container' ); update_post_meta( $post_ID, 'theme-transparent-header-meta', 'enabled' ); update_post_meta( $post_ID, 'site-sidebar-layout', 'no-sidebar' ); update_post_meta( $post_ID, 'site-post-title', 'disabled' ); } } /** * Get customizer json * * @since 4.0.0 * @return mixed value. */ public function get_customizer_json() { try { $request = wp_remote_get( ASTRA_THEME_URI . 'inc/compatibility/starter-content/astra-settings-export.json' ); } catch ( Exception $ex ) { $request = null; } if ( is_wp_error( $request ) ) { return false; // Bail early. } // @codingStandardsIgnoreStart /** * @psalm-suppress PossiblyNullReference * @psalm-suppress UndefinedMethod * @psalm-suppress PossiblyNullArrayAccess * @psalm-suppress PossiblyNullArgument * @psalm-suppress InvalidScalarArgument */ return json_decode( $request['body'], 1 ); // @codingStandardsIgnoreEnd } /** * Save Astra customizer settings into database. * * @since 4.0.0 */ public function save_astra_settings() { $settings = self::get_customizer_json(); // Delete existing dynamic CSS cache. delete_option( 'astra-settings' ); if ( ! empty( $settings['customizer-settings'] ) ) { foreach ( $settings['customizer-settings'] as $option => $value ) { update_option( $option, $value ); } } } /** * Load default astra settings.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-settings']; } return $json ? $json : $defaults; } /** * Load default color palettes. * * @since 4.0.0 * @param mixed $defaults defaults. * @return mixed value. */ public function theme_color_palettes_defaults( $defaults ) { $json = ''; $settings = self::get_customizer_json(); if ( ! empty( $settings['customizer-settings'] ) ) { $json = $settings['customizer-settings']['astra-color-palettes']; } return $json ? $json : $defaults; } /** * Return starter content definition. * * @return mixed|void * @since 4.0.0 */ public function get() { $nav_items_header = array( 'home' => array( 'type' => 'post_type', 'object' => 'page', 'object_id' => '{{' . self::HOME_SLUG . '}}', ), 'about' => array( 'title' => __( 'Services',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::SERVICES_SLUG . '}}', ), 'services' => array( 'title' => __( 'About',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::ABOUT_SLUG . '}}', ), 'reviews' => array( 'title' => __( 'Reviews',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::REVIEWS_SLUG . '}}', ), 'faq' => array( 'title' => __( 'Why Us',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::WHY_US_SLUG . '}}', ), 'contact' => array( 'title' => __( 'Contact', 'astra' ), 'type' => 'custom', 'url' => '{{' . self::CONTACT_SLUG . '}}', ), ); $content = array( 'attachments' => array( 'logo' => array( 'post_title' => _x( 'Logo', 'Theme starter content', 'astra' ), 'file' => 'inc/assets/images/starter-content/logo.png', ), ), 'theme_mods' => array( 'custom_logo' => '{{logo}}', ), 'nav_menus' => array( 'primary'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), 'mobile_menu' => array( 'name' => esc_html__( 'Primary', 'astra' ), 'items' => $nav_items_header, ), ), 'options' => array( 'page_on_front' => '{{' . self::HOME_SLUG . '}}', 'show_on_front' => 'page', ), 'posts' => array( self::HOME_SLUG => require ASTRA_THEME_DIR . 'inc/compatibility/starter-content/home.php', // PHPCS:ignore W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ound ), ); return apply_filters( 'astra_starter_content', $content ); } } Upplev Spännande Gameplay på Leon Casino: Din Port till Oändlig Underhållning - Bun Apeti - Burgers and more

Upplev Spännande Gameplay på Leon Casino: Din Port till Oändlig Underhållning

Leon Casino är en online gamingplattform som erbjuder ett stort utbud av spel, som täcker olika kategorier såsom Slots, Live Casino, Table Games, Jackpots och Video Poker. Med över 12 000 spel att välja mellan är spelare bortskämda med valmöjligheter, och spänningen tar aldrig slut.

Oavsett om du är en erfaren spelare eller nybörjare inom onlinecasinovärlden, Leon Casino har något för alla. Dess användarvänliga gränssnitt och sömlösa navigering gör det enkelt att hitta dina favoritspel, och plattformens imponerande samling säkerställer att du aldrig blir uttråkad.

En av de utmärkande funktionerna hos Leon Casino är dess engagemang för att erbjuda en exceptionell spelupplevelse. Med över 50 leverantörer ombord, inklusive branschledare som Pragmatic Play, NetEnt och Evolution Gaming, kan spelare förvänta sig högkvalitativa spel och ett brett utbud av alternativ.

Utforska Världen av Live Casino hos Leon

Live Casino-sektionen på Leon är en skattkista av spänning, som erbjuder ett varierat urval av spel som håller dig på helspänn. Från klassiska bordsspel som Roulette och Blackjack till immersiva upplevelser som Live Poker och Baccarat, är Live Casino på Leon den perfekta destinationen för de som söker en mer autentisk spelupplevelse.

Med ett utbud av insatsgränser och spelvarianter att välja mellan kan spelare anpassa sin upplevelse efter sina preferenser. Oavsett om du är high-roller eller en casual spelare, säkerställer Live Casino på Leon att du alltid hittar ett spel som passar din stil.

Nyckelfunktioner för Live Casino på Leon

  • Immersiv spelupplevelse med live dealers
  • Variationsrikt urval av spel, inklusive Roulette, Blackjack och Poker
  • Olika insatsgränser för att passa olika spelares preferenser
  • Interaktion i realtid med andra spelare och dealers

Spänningen med Slot Games på Leon

För dig som föredrar spänningen av Slot Games har Leon Casino ett otroligt utbud med över 10 000 titlar att välja mellan. Med teman som sträcker sig från klassiska fruktmaskiner till moderna video slots finns det något för varje smak och preferens.

Oavsett om du är ute efter stora vinster eller bara vill njuta av en rolig och underhållande upplevelse, kommer Slot Games på Leon garanterat att leverera. Med nya spel som tillkommer regelbundet hittar du alltid något nytt och spännande att prova.

Nyckelfunktioner för Slot Games på Leon

  • Massivt urval av över 10 000 Slot Games
  • Olika teman och spelstilar för att passa olika preferenser
  • Nya spel tillkommer regelbundet för att hålla upplevelsen fräsch
  • Högkvalitativa grafik och ljud för en immersiv upplevelse

Kom Igång med Leon Casino

Att komma igång med Leon Casino är enkelt och tydligt. Registrera dig bara för ett konto, gör en insättning och du är redo att utforska det stora utbudet av spel som finns tillgängliga.

Med en generös välkomstbonus på upp till €20 000 och 100 free spins kan nya spelare njuta av en spännande introduktion till onlinegamingvärlden. Dessutom, med pågående kampanjer och belöningar för lojala spelare, finns det alltid något att se fram emot.

Nyckelfunktioner för Leon Casinos Välkomstbonus

  • 100 free spins för att komma igång
  • Ingen insättning krävs för att hämta bonusen
  • Enkelt att förstå villkor och regler

Mobilspel på Leon Casino

Leon Casino är helt optimerat för mobila enheter, vilket gör att spelare kan njuta av sina favoritspel på språng. Med en dedikerad app för Android-enheter kan spelare nå plattformens stora utbud av spel var som helst, när som helst.

Oavsett om du pendlar till jobbet eller väntar i kö, säkerställer mobilspel på Leon Casino att du aldrig missar actionen.

Nyckelfunktioner för Leon Casinos Mobilapp

  • Dedikerad app för Android-enheter
  • Helt optimerad för mobila enheter
  • Tillgång till över 12 000 spel på språng
  • Användarvänligt gränssnitt för sömlös navigering

En Säker och Pålitlig Spelupplevelse

På Leon Casino är din säkerhet och trygghet vår högsta prioritet. Med robust krypteringsteknik och regelbundna säkerhetsgranskningar säkerställer vi att din personliga och finansiella information är skyddad hela tiden.

Plus, med våra strikta anti-penningtvättpolicyer och ansvarsfulla spelåtgärder kan du njuta av din spelupplevelse med förtroende.

En Gemenskap av Spelare på Leon Casino

Leon Casino är mer än bara en spelplattform – det är en gemenskap av likasinnade individer som delar passionen för onlinegaming. Med sociala funktioner och interaktiva inslag integrerade i plattformen kan du koppla samman med andra spelare, dela tips och strategier, och delta i diskussioner.

Oavsett om du söker råd från erfarna spelare eller bara vill dela dina erfarenheter med andra, är gemenskapen på Leon Casino den perfekta platsen för att knyta kontakter med andra spelentusiaster.

Nyckelfunktioner för Leon Casinos Gemenskap

  • Sociala funktioner för att koppla samman med andra spelare
  • Interaktiva inslag för att dela tips och strategier
  • Dedikerat forum för diskussioner och Q&A
  • Regelbundna evenemang och turneringar för gemenskapsengagemang

Gaming Control Board of Anjouan License: Säkerställer Rättvist Spel och Transparens

Gaming Control Board of Anjouan-licensen säkerställer att alla spel som erbjuds av Leon Casino uppfyller de högsta standarderna för rättvisa och transparens. Vårt engagemang för ansvarsfullt spelande innebär att du kan njuta av din spelupplevelse med förtroende.

Med regelbundna granskningar och efterlevnad av strikta riktlinjer garanterar vi att varje spel som spelas på Leon Casino är rättvist och opartiskt.

En Port till Oändlig Underhållning: Slutsats

Få Din Välkomstbonus!

Upplev spänningen med onlinegaming på Leon Casino – din port till oändlig underhållning. Med över 12 000 spel att välja mellan, en generös välkomstbonus på upp till €20 000 och pågående kampanjer för lojala spelare, har det aldrig funnits en bättre tid att gå med i actionen.

Registrera dig nu och upptäck varför Leon Casino är den ultimata destinationen för spelare världen över.

/** * Template part for displaying the footer info. * * @link https://codex.wordpress.org/Template_Hierarchy * * @package Astra * @since 1.0.0 */ ?>
Scroll to Top